Rockfax Description
The wide black rift is oddly alluring. A short polished corner leads to easier ground heading for the large boulder blocking the rift. Either squeeze through the rat-hole that gripped Helfenstein, or do the Outside Exit at an exposed S 4a. © Rockfax

FA. Helfenstein - well almost. c1910.

Sean Kelly 23 Sep, 2019 Show βeta
βeta: After much futile huffing & puffing, grapple & wrestle, swearing & gasping, battle & bash, scrapping and fighting, scuffling & tussle, screaming & shouting, in a vain hopeless wasted exertion that I utterly failed to negotiate an exit via squeezing through the vice-like crevice. So finally in desperation I resorted to the much easier outside finish at only S 4a. No small wonder Helfenstein gave up climbing immediately afterwards!

Fidget 30 Oct, 2005 Show βeta
βeta: The chimney part was like a slimey river when I led this today, but it didn't matter as it's all about the last move. Just about managed to squeeze through with a lot of puffing and panting! Highly amusing, the the more you try and push with your feet, the more you get stuck. I tried it facing left, and by the time I realised I should have faced right it was too late to turn round!
